About the Program

The Bachelor in Animal Management with Science (Top-Up) at Askham Bryan College is for students with a Foundation Degree, HND, or equivalent. This one-year program helps students deepen their understanding of animal management and applied animal sciences, preparing them for roles in the animal-related sectors.

The curriculum includes core modules like Sustainable Development in the Animal Industry and Enclosure Design and Stock Management, alongside elective options. Students engage in practical skills in animal health and management, and apply their learning in real-world scenarios.

Graduates can pursue careers as research scientists, animal behaviourists, and animal nutritionists. They may also choose to further their studies by enrolling in Master's or PhD programs, working with employers in animal conservation, research, and welfare organizations.
